Transaction 1cb70a71a2d2918ba96c9cb75d880b86dcbc95bd0ce31c7011fa284e76b45609
2 Input
1 Outputs
- 1cb70a71a2d2918ba96c9cb75d880b86dcbc95bd0ce31c7011fa284e76b45609:0
value 47528471
address 3BMEXh2ebkLYj8Nh19nFkVKN8of5byAJvL